Insulation and Heat Retention

When evaluating thermal insulation and heat retention, both skylights and conventional windows offer different energy efficiency qualities. Skylights are often made with multiple layers of glass and specialized coatings, which can enhance thermal insulation. However, their positioning angle and the risk of heat loss through the roof can contribute to higher energy demands, particularly in colder climates. On the other hand, traditional windows can offer effective insulation if equipped with double or triple glazing. They are generally mounted vertically, which may lower heat loss in comparison to skylights. The surrounding framing and building materials also greatly impact total energy efficiency. Ultimately, selecting between skylights and conventional windows for the best insulation and heat retention relies on factors including climate, installation quality, and particular design considerations.

Upkeep Considerations for Skylights and Windows

Even though skylights and conventional windows each boost a home's natural light, their care demands differ significantly. Traditional windows usually demand regular cleaning to maintain clarity and prevent the buildup of dirt and grime. Homeowners are also advised to check seals and frames periodically for any signs of wear or damage, particularly in older windows that may be prone to leaks.

By comparison, skylights demand a higher level of dedicated maintenance. Their raised placement can complicate the cleaning process, and debris can collect on their surfaces. Additionally, skylights are more susceptible to water leaks if not properly installed. Regular inspection of flashing and seals is essential to ensure continued performance. Homeowners should also take into account the material of the skylight, as some may require specific maintenance routines to minimize degradation. As a result, recognizing the distinct maintenance needs of each option is essential for lasting satisfaction.

Can Skylights Be Opened for Ventilation Like Traditional Windows?

Yes, certain skylights can be opened for air circulation, much like traditional windows. These functional skylights permit fresh air to circulate, enhancing indoor comfort levels and improving air quality, rendering them a flexible option for those who own homes.

What Effect Do Skylights Have on Indoor Temperature During Summer?

Skylights can greatly increase temperatures inside a home during the warmer season, enabling sunlight to enter and heat interior areas. Without sufficient airflow or shading measures, this buildup of heat can result in significant discomfort, necessitating additional cooling measures to maintain a comfortable environment.

Are Skylights susceptible to Leaks or Water Damage?

Skylights are susceptible to leaks and water damage when they are not properly installed or maintained. Routine inspections and high-quality materials are crucial for mitigating risks and maximizing their durability, thus safeguarding the adjacent structures from possible moisture problems.

What Is the Lifespan of a Typical Skylight?

Most skylights have a functional lifespan ranging from 15 to 30 years, influenced by the materials and how well it was installed. Regular maintenance can extend its longevity, as environmental elements can impact how well it performs over time.

What Are the Differences in Installation Costs Between Skylights and Windows?

Skylight installation costs typically surpass those of conventional windows as a result of the extra structural changes needed. Nevertheless, sustained energy savings and improved natural lighting can compensate for these upfront costs, rendering them a valuable investment for certain homeowners.
